Similar to #989, but now occurring only when Microbundle's target is not Node.js. I'm compiling a library that runs in both Node.js and a browser, and the library contains dynamic imports for node built-ins like 'fs', executed only in Node.js.
When importing
fs
I can add the following to mypackage.json
and everything works fine:However, using
node:fs
, the same thing does not work, and warnings appear with:Microbundle v0.15.1, Node.js v18.12.1.
